Getting Help and Assistance
- There is a member of staff available for help and assistance.
- There is not a member of staff trained in British Sign Language.
- British Sign Language interpreters can be provided on request.
- There is an assistance dog toilet or toileting area at the stadium/near by.
- Water bowls for assistance dogs are available.
- There are mobility aids available.
- The mobility aids available include wheelchairs.

Getting Here
-
By Road
View
- Swansea.com Stadium is located on the outskirts of Swansea. There are various routes to the stadium. If you are coming from the East/West then follow the M4 and exit at Junction 45. Follow the signs along the A4067 until you reach the stadium.
- Swansea.com Stadium has 2 on-site car parks available; West Car Park and North Car Park.

Outer Concourse
- The outer concourse has a concrete surface and is step-free throughout. All stands are accessible via the outer concourse.
- All entrances into the stadium have step-free access.
- Clear directional signage is provided on the concourse.
- There is a stadium plan/map on the concourse.
- There is a steward/member of staff available for assistance on matchdays.

Outside Access (Main Entrance)
-
Entrance
View
- This information is for the entrance located on the south corner of the Swansea University - West Stand.
- The entrance area/door is clearly signed.
- There is step-free access at this entrance.
- There is not a canopy or recess which provides weather protection at this entrance.
- The entrance door(s) does not/do not contrast visually with its immediate surroundings.
- The main door(s) open(s) automatically (away from you).
- The main automatic door(s) is/are push pad or push button activated.
- The push pad or push button is 80cm from floor level.
- The door(s) is/are double width.
- The width of the door opening is 190cm.
- There is a small lip on the threshold of the entrance, with a height of 2cm or below.
- There are security barriers at this entrance.
- There is a member of staff available for assistance at this entrance.

Shop
-
Inside Access
View
- There is step-free access throughout the aisles.
- The majority of aisles have a clear width of 100cm+ and are clear of obstructions.
- The flooring throughout the aisles is carpet.
- There is high colour contrast between the walls and floor in the majority of areas.
- Background music is played.
- The lighting levels are varied.
-
Till(s)/Counter(s)
View
- There is/are 2 till(s)/counter(s) available.
- There is a/are payment counter(s) and shirt printing counter(s) available.
- All tills are located on the right as you enter the shop.
There are six payment tills and one shirt printing counter.
The accessible service point is clearly signed. - There is step-free access to the till(s)/counter(s).
- There is a clear accessible route to the till(s)/counter(s).
- The nearest till(s)/counter(s) is/are approximately 19m from the main entrance.
- There are not windows, TVs, glazed screens or mirrors behind the till(s)/counter(s) which could adversely affect the ability of someone to lip read.
- The till(s)/counter(s) is/are not placed in front of a background which is patterned.
- The height of the till(s)/counter(s) is/are medium height (77cm - 109cm).
- There is not a low section at the till(s)/counter(s) with a height of 76cm or below.
- There is a hearing assistance system at the till(s)/counter(s).
- The hearing assistance system(s) is/are portable.
- The hearing assistance system(s) is/are signed.
- Staff are trained to use the system.
- The portable hearing loop is on the end accessible till and is available on request.
Exit
-
Exit
View
- This information is for the exit located immediately beyond the payment tills.
- The exit area/door is not clearly signed internally.
- The exit is step-free.
- The exit door(s) does not/do not contrast visually with its immediate surroundings.
- There is not a canopy or recess which provides weather protection at this exit.
- The door(s) open(s) both ways.
- The door(s) is/are double width.
- The door(s) may be difficult to open.
- The width of the door opening is 180cm.
- There is a small lip on the threshold of the exit, with a height of 2cm or below.
- There are security barriers at this exit.
- The minimum width between the security barriers is 178cm.
- There is a member of staff available for assistance at this exit.
